titleOfInvention Developing device
abstract A developing device includes: a developing container, a feeding member, a developer carrying member, and a collecting device. A coverage which is a percentage of coating of surfaces of the carrier particles with the toner particles is 100% or more and 200% or less. The developer carrying member has a plurality of recessed portions formed on a surface thereof so that at least the toner particles having an average particle size are contactable with inner surfaces of the recessed portions and the carrier particles having an average particle size are not contactable with the inner surfaces of the recessed portions. The recessed portions are formed so that not less than halves of the toner particles having the average particle size are exposed from the recessed portions when the toner particles having the average particle size enter the recessed portions.
